
最近遇到 TP(TokenPocket)钱包无法转账的问题并不罕见,表面现象是“发送失败”“交易卡在 pending”,但本质可能并非单一错误。首先从链层诊断:常见原因包括选错网络(例如在 BSC 上尝试发送 ETH)、RPC 节点不可用、链上拥堵或 gas 价格估算偏低导致交易无法被打包。节点不稳定会引发钱包无法广播或读取 nonce,从而报错“nonce 有冲突”或“交易重复”。

代币与合约层问题同样重要:部分代币有转账税或需要提前 approve 合约,NFT 转移受限于合约白名单或转移钩子(hook),若合约实现了复杂的权限控制或暂停功能,会直接阻止普通转账。再有,智能合约的防重放、链间兼容性不足或跨链桥问题也会造成转账失败。
从密码学视角,签名错误或私钥导入异常也会阻断转账:签名算法(如 ECDSA)若与链的签名格式不匹配,或签名返回被客户端误解析,交易会被节点拒绝。另一个隐蔽原因是密钥管理方案或去中心化身份(DID):当钱包集成身份层并对签名策略做额外限制(例如基于 DID 的多签条件),未经授权的签名将无法广播。
实时行情预测与金融模型对转账行为也有间接影响:行情剧烈波https://www.shxcjhb.com ,动导致 gas 市场剧变,自动估价策略失准,尤其在高频交易或 NFT drop 期间,MEV(矿工可提取价值)竞争会推高打包费或触发前置取消策略。高科技金融模式如闪电贷、流动性挖矿事件会瞬时改变链上负载,令普通用户转账失败。
实务性建议(技术路线图):1)核对网络与代币合约地址,确保在正确链上操作;2)切换或自定义稳定 RPC 节点,重置 nonce,若有 pending 交易可尝试加价替换(replace-by-fee);3)检查代币是否需 approve 或合约是否有 transfer 限制;4)确认钱包版本与签名格式兼容,必要时重新导入私钥并验证私钥与地址匹配;5)针对 NFT,查询合约事件日志与白名单规则;6)关注实时行情与 gas 监测工具,避免高峰期操作。
结论:TP 钱包转账失败是多因素交织的系统性问题,从底层 RPC、签名与 nonce,到合约逻辑、市场微结构与去中心化身份控制都可能是导火索。把故障视为层级诊断问题,逐层排查并结合实时链上数据与合约审计,可以在绝大多数场景下恢复正常交易流程并减少未来风险。
评论
SkyWalker
对 RPC 节点的提醒太及时了,之前就是换了节点问题解决,受益匪浅。
阿莲
关于 NFT 合约钩子这一点很少有人提,读后茅塞顿开。
CoinSage
建议再补充一个步骤:如何安全地在手机上替换 nonce,避免泄露私钥。
链探
把 MEV 和行情波动联系起来的分析非常到位,实战参考价值高。